Russell Westbrook to play vs. Warriors in opener

The Golden State Warriors are about to host the Los Angeles Lakers on the first night of the 2022-23 NBA season, and we now know that the Lakers will have all their stars. Shortly before the game, the Lakers confirmed that point guard Russell Westbrook, who had been listed as probable, will play in the game.

Westbrook was a pretty big question mark after injuring his hamstring during the Lakers final preseason game of the year. But the injury was apparently quite minor, and he’s good to go. Fellow future Hall of Famers LeBron James and Anthony Davis were also listed as probable on the injury report, but no one thought there was any chance that they’d actually miss the game.
